Ingredients:
1 (9-inch) pre-baked pie crust (homemade or store-bought)
1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ips
½ cup unsalted butter (1 stick)
¾ cup granulated sugar
¼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
2 large eggs
1 tsp vanilla extract
½ cup heavy cream
¼ cup all-purpose flour
Pinch of salt
1 cup mixed nuts (pecans, walnuts, almonds, or hazelnuts), roughly chopped
¼ cup chocolate sauce or melted chocolate (for drizzle)
Whipped cream, for topping (optional)
Instructions:
Melt the Chocolate:
In a saucepan over low heat, melt butter and chocolate chips until smooth. Stir in sugar and cocoa powder.
Make the Batter:
Whisk in eggs one at a time, then add vanilla and heavy cream. Stir in flour and salt until glossy. Fold in chopped nuts.
Bake the Pie:
Pour filling into crust and bake at 350°F for 25–30 minutes, until set around edges but slightly soft in center. Cool completely.
Add the Topping:
Drizzle with melted chocolate and add extra nuts on top. Finish with whipped cream if desired.
